數(shù)碼管是FPGA開發(fā)板上用于數(shù)字顯示的外設(shè),分為共陰極和共陽(yáng)極兩種類型,通常以4位或8位組合形式存在,可顯示0-9的數(shù)字和部分字母。其工作原理是通過FPGA輸出的段選信號(hào)(控制顯示的數(shù)字或字母)和位選信號(hào)(控制點(diǎn)亮的數(shù)碼管),實(shí)現(xiàn)動(dòng)態(tài)掃描顯示。在數(shù)字計(jì)數(shù)、時(shí)鐘設(shè)計(jì)等項(xiàng)目中,數(shù)碼管可直觀顯示數(shù)值信息,例如顯示計(jì)數(shù)器的當(dāng)前數(shù)值、定時(shí)器的剩余時(shí)間。部分開發(fā)板會(huì)集成數(shù)碼管驅(qū)動(dòng)芯片,將FPGA的并行控制信號(hào)轉(zhuǎn)換為數(shù)碼管所需的驅(qū)動(dòng)信號(hào),減少FPGA引腳占用;也有開發(fā)板直接通過FPGA引腳驅(qū)動(dòng)數(shù)碼管,適合教學(xué)場(chǎng)景,幫助學(xué)生理解動(dòng)態(tài)掃描顯示的原理。在顯示控制中,需注意掃描頻率的設(shè)置,通常需高于50Hz以避免肉眼觀察到閃爍現(xiàn)象,提升顯示效果。 FPGA 開發(fā)板是否提供溫度保護(hù)機(jī)制?湖南嵌入式FPGA開發(fā)板教學(xué)

通信系統(tǒng)需要處理大量的高速信號(hào),包括信號(hào)調(diào)制解調(diào)、編碼解碼、數(shù)據(jù)轉(zhuǎn)發(fā)等,F(xiàn)PGA開發(fā)板憑借其高速信號(hào)處理能力和靈活的接口,成為通信系統(tǒng)開發(fā)的重要工具。在無(wú)線通信場(chǎng)景中,F(xiàn)PGA開發(fā)板可實(shí)現(xiàn)基帶信號(hào)處理,如OFDM調(diào)制解調(diào)、卷積碼編碼解碼,支持4G、5G等通信標(biāo)準(zhǔn);在有線通信場(chǎng)景中,可實(shí)現(xiàn)以太網(wǎng)、光纖通信的信號(hào)處理,如TCP/IP協(xié)議棧加速、光信號(hào)的編解碼。部分FPGA開發(fā)板集成高速串行接口,如10G/25GEthernet、PCIe,支持高速數(shù)據(jù)傳輸;還會(huì)集成射頻前端模塊,方便連接天線,實(shí)現(xiàn)無(wú)線信號(hào)的收發(fā)。在通信設(shè)備研發(fā)中,F(xiàn)PGA開發(fā)板可作為原型平臺(tái),驗(yàn)證新的通信算法或協(xié)議,例如測(cè)試5GNR(新無(wú)線)技術(shù)的信號(hào)處理性能,或驗(yàn)證衛(wèi)星通信中的抗干擾算法,確保通信系統(tǒng)的穩(wěn)定性和可靠性。 江蘇專注FPGA開發(fā)板論壇FPGA 開發(fā)板示例代碼提供設(shè)計(jì)模板參考。

FPGA開發(fā)板在機(jī)器人領(lǐng)域發(fā)揮著作用,助力機(jī)器人實(shí)現(xiàn)更加智能的動(dòng)作。在工業(yè)機(jī)器人中,開發(fā)板用于處理機(jī)器人運(yùn)動(dòng)算法,根據(jù)預(yù)設(shè)的路徑和任務(wù)要求,精確機(jī)器人各個(gè)關(guān)節(jié)的運(yùn)動(dòng)。通過與電機(jī)驅(qū)動(dòng)器通信,開發(fā)板向電機(jī)發(fā)送信號(hào),實(shí)現(xiàn)對(duì)電機(jī)轉(zhuǎn)速、轉(zhuǎn)矩和位置的精確調(diào)節(jié),從而保證機(jī)器人能夠準(zhǔn)確地完成各種復(fù)雜的操作,如搬運(yùn)、裝配、焊接等任務(wù)。在服務(wù)機(jī)器人中,開發(fā)板除了負(fù)責(zé)運(yùn)動(dòng)外,還承擔(dān)著人機(jī)交互和環(huán)境感知數(shù)據(jù)處理的任務(wù)。開發(fā)板接收來自攝像頭、麥克風(fēng)、超聲波傳感器等設(shè)備采集的環(huán)境信息,通過算法對(duì)這些信息進(jìn)行分析和理解,使機(jī)器人能夠感知周圍環(huán)境,與人類進(jìn)行自然交互。例如,服務(wù)機(jī)器人在遇到障礙物時(shí),開發(fā)板根據(jù)傳感器數(shù)據(jù)及時(shí)調(diào)整機(jī)器人的運(yùn)動(dòng)方向,避免碰撞;在與用戶交流時(shí),開發(fā)板對(duì)語(yǔ)音信號(hào)進(jìn)行處理和識(shí)別,理解用戶的指令并做出相應(yīng)的回應(yīng),提升機(jī)器人的智能化水平和服務(wù)質(zhì)量。
FPGA開發(fā)板在教育教學(xué)中具有重要的價(jià)值。對(duì)于高校電子信息類的學(xué)生而言,開發(fā)板是將理論知識(shí)轉(zhuǎn)化為實(shí)踐能力的重要媒介。在數(shù)字電路課程學(xué)習(xí)中,學(xué)生通過在開發(fā)板上實(shí)現(xiàn)簡(jiǎn)單的邏輯電路,如計(jì)數(shù)器、譯碼器等,直觀地理解數(shù)字電路的工作原理與設(shè)計(jì)方法。在學(xué)習(xí)硬件描述語(yǔ)言時(shí),學(xué)生利用開發(fā)板進(jìn)行實(shí)際項(xiàng)目練習(xí),從簡(jiǎn)單的LED閃爍到復(fù)雜的數(shù)碼管動(dòng)態(tài)顯示,逐步掌握Verilog或VHDL語(yǔ)言的編程技巧。在綜合性課程設(shè)計(jì)與畢業(yè)設(shè)計(jì)中,開發(fā)板更是學(xué)生展示創(chuàng)新能力的平臺(tái)。學(xué)生可以基于開發(fā)板開展如智能小車設(shè)計(jì)、簡(jiǎn)易數(shù)字示波器制作等項(xiàng)目,綜合運(yùn)用多門課程所學(xué)知識(shí),鍛煉系統(tǒng)設(shè)計(jì)、調(diào)試與優(yōu)化的能力,培養(yǎng)學(xué)生的工程實(shí)踐素養(yǎng)與創(chuàng)新思維,為未來從事電子信息相關(guān)行業(yè)的工作奠定堅(jiān)實(shí)的基礎(chǔ)。FPGA 開發(fā)板工業(yè)級(jí)型號(hào)適應(yīng)復(fù)雜環(huán)境測(cè)試。

FPGA開發(fā)板的功耗管理是開發(fā)者需要關(guān)注的重要方面。在便攜式設(shè)備或電池供電的應(yīng)用場(chǎng)景中,降低開發(fā)板功耗尤為關(guān)鍵。開發(fā)者可通過優(yōu)化FPGA邏輯設(shè)計(jì),減少不必要的邏輯翻轉(zhuǎn),降低芯片動(dòng)態(tài)功耗。合理配置開發(fā)板外設(shè),在不使用時(shí)將其設(shè)置為低功耗模式,進(jìn)一步降低系統(tǒng)功耗。部分開發(fā)板提供專門的功耗管理模塊,幫助開發(fā)者監(jiān)控與調(diào)節(jié)功耗,通過軟件設(shè)置實(shí)現(xiàn)不同的功耗管理策略。良好的功耗管理使FPGA開發(fā)板能夠在低功耗狀態(tài)下穩(wěn)定運(yùn)行,滿足特定應(yīng)用場(chǎng)景對(duì)功耗的嚴(yán)格要求,延長(zhǎng)設(shè)備續(xù)航時(shí)間。FPGA 開發(fā)板是硬件學(xué)習(xí)者的必備設(shè)備!湖北初學(xué)FPGA開發(fā)板學(xué)習(xí)視頻
FPGA 開發(fā)板邏輯分析儀接口支持信號(hào)采集。湖南嵌入式FPGA開發(fā)板教學(xué)
,需依賴外部配置存儲(chǔ)器實(shí)現(xiàn)上電自動(dòng)加載設(shè)計(jì)文件。開發(fā)板常用的配置存儲(chǔ)器包括SPIFlash、ParallelFlash和SD卡,其中SPIFlash因體積小、功耗低、成本適中成為主流選擇,容量通常從8MB到128MB不等,可存儲(chǔ)多個(gè)FPGA配置文件,支持通過板載按鍵切換加載不同設(shè)計(jì)。ParallelFlash則具備更快的讀取速度,適合對(duì)配置時(shí)間要求嚴(yán)格的場(chǎng)景,但占用PCB空間更大。部分開發(fā)板還支持通過JTAG接口直接從計(jì)算機(jī)加載配置文件,無(wú)需依賴外部存儲(chǔ)器,這種方式在開發(fā)調(diào)試階段尤為便捷,開發(fā)者可快速燒錄修改后的代碼,驗(yàn)證邏輯功能,而無(wú)需頻繁插拔存儲(chǔ)設(shè)備。 湖南嵌入式FPGA開發(fā)板教學(xué)